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) 1. How much does it cost to install a cat flap? The cost of installing a cat flap can differ substantially based upon numerous factors, including the type of flap, materials, and labor expenses. On average, you can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 100 and ₤ 300 for professional installation.
- 2. What type of cat flap should I choose? The option of cat flap depends upon a number of aspects, consisting of the size of your cat, the door or wall specifics, and your security needs. There are manual flaps, microchip-activated flaps, and advanced choices that provide included security functions.
- 3. Can I set up a cat flap myself? While some DIY lovers might feel great installing a cat flap themselves, it's recommended to hire specialists to guarantee the fit, security, and looks are perfect.
- 4. The length of time does it take to set up a cat flap? Usually, professional installation can take between one to 3 hours, depending on the complexity of the installation and the kind of flap being fitted.
